COMPETITION SCHEDULE COMPETITION SCHEDULE COMPETITION SCHEDULE COMPETITION SCHEDULE Tuesday 14 th July Arrival and practice day/ captains' meeting / draw ceremony Wednesday 15 th July First day of competition / welcome party Sunday 19 th July Finals / Prize giving ceremony immediately after the finals Monday 20 July Official departure day ADULT ADULT ADULT ADULT COMPET COMPET COMPET COMPETIT IT IT ITION ION ION ION FORMAT FORMAT FORMAT FORMAT The competition is a knock-out format with a reverse draw to provide a finishing position for each nation. A tie is comprised of one Men's Doubles, one Women's Doubles and one Mixed Doubles match. Each team must consist of a minimum of two male players and two female players and a maximum of three male and three female players. Each nation has the right to include a non-playing captain in their team or to nominate a playing member of their team as captain. RANKINGS RANKINGS RANKINGS RANKINGS ITF Beach Tennis Ranking points will be awarded to players based on their team's final standing for that year. To receive Ranking points, a player must have played and won a minimum of one (1) live doubles match. Players in a team that finishes in a top four position must win a minimum of two (2) live doubles matches to receive full points or one (1) live match to receive 50% of points available. A 'live match' is defined as any match, the result of which could affect the outcome of the tie. For avoidance of doubt, a decisive Mixed Doubles match is a 'live match'. Please refer to Appendix B 'Tournament Grades and Ranking Points' in the ITF Beach Tennis Tour Rules and Regulations for full details.
